We are seeking an experienced Veterinary Technician to join and help lead our team. As a Veterinary Technician, you will help oversee clinic operations and guide our team of Veterinary Technicians and Assistants in providing high-quality care to our animal patients.
Overview
Your responsibilities will include performing various medical procedures, administering medications, and assisting with surgeries.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in animal care and possess excellent technical skills. Duties
Administer medications, vaccines, and treatments as directed by veterinarians Perform laboratory tests such as blood work, urinalysis, and fecal examinations Prepare animals for surgery and assist during surgical procedures Monitor anesthesia during surgeries and recovery periods Perform x-rays Provide compassionate care to animals and their owners Educate pet owners on proper animal care and nutrition Maintain accurate medical records Directing workflow on the floor Assist in the educational development of technicians and their skills Requirements
Previous experience as a Veterinary Technician is highly desirable Strong technical skills for common procedures Proficient in animal handling and restraint techniques Strong communication skills, both verbal and written Excellent organizational skills with attention to detail Job Types: Full-time, Part-time Benefits
